Changeset 7772


Ignore:
Timestamp:
Jul 19, 2018, 8:56:23 AM (12 months ago)
Author:
jrpelegrina
Message:

Improved vterminal

Location:
dpkg-unlocker/trunk/fuentes/dpkgunlocker-gui/python3-dpkgunlocker-gui
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• dpkg-unlocker/trunk/fuentes/dpkgunlocker-gui/python3-dpkgunlocker-gui/MainWindow.py

    r7759 r7772  
    218218               
    219219                if response==Gtk.ResponseType.YES:
    220                         self.core.processBox.vterminal.set_input_enabled(True)
     220                        self.core.processBox.manage_vterminal(True,False)
    221221                        self.unlock_button.set_sensitive(False)
    222222                        self.process_box.terminal_viewport.show()
     
    312312                                                                                self.fixing_result=self.check_process("Fixing")
    313313
    314                                                                         self.core.processBox.vterminal.set_input_enabled(False)
     314                                                                        self.core.processBox.manage_vterminal(False,True)
    315315                                                                        if self.fixing_result:
    316316                                                                                msg=self.get_msg_text(5)
     
    339339
    340340                        if error:
     341                                self.core.processBox.manage_vterminal(False,True)
    341342                                msg_error=self.get_msg_text(code)
    342343                                self.process_box.terminal_label.set_name("MSG_ERROR_LABEL")
  • dpkg-unlocker/trunk/fuentes/dpkgunlocker-gui/python3-dpkgunlocker-gui/ProcessBox.py

    r7439 r7772  
    223223        #def write_status_log                                   
    224224
     225        def manage_vterminal(self,enabled_input,sensitive):
     226
     227                self.vterminal.set_input_enabled(enabled_input)
     228                self.vterminal.set_sensitive(sensitive)
     229
     230        #def manage_vterminal
    225231
    226232#class ProcessBox
Note: See TracChangeset for help on using the changeset viewer.